Tour Edge is a good company. I had an original Exotics 3wood in my bag for 8 years...best fairway wood I've ever owned.

I get a kick out of some of these guys who claim they play better with one brand or another. In reality, all of the major golf equipment companies make good stuff. I work in the golf business, still have a 3.0 index at age 68, and have a mixed bag...TaylorMade SLDR driver and 3wood, Adams A12Pro hybrids (#3 and #4), Mizuno MP-H4 irons (5 through PW), Ping Tour wedges (50, 54, & 58 degree), and a TaylorMade Daddy Long Legs putter. Over the years I've probably played more Ping equipment than anything, but I'd never consider having everything in my bag be from just one club company.
